Bonuses That Feel Player-Friendly: From Welcome Perks to Weekly Boosts

Promotions at CyberBet strike a balance between generous and straightforward, starting with their casino welcome bonus that matches your first deposit 100% up to €300, plus 20 free spins on slots like Book of Gold: Symbol Choice—just punch in the code GETMAX20 during signup. It's non-sticky, so you play with your own cash first, which is a smart setup if you hit a win early and want to cash out without touching the bonus wagering. Speaking of which, the 20x requirement on the bonus amount only (not your deposit) is lighter than many spots, giving you a fair shot at turning it into real money within the three-day window.

Beyond the intro offer, reload bonuses keep the momentum going with another 100% match up to €300 on subsequent deposits, activated via a simple opt-in button. Then there's the Wednesday cashback, dishing out 10% on net losses from casino games—automatically credited and with the same 20x playthrough, it's like a safety net for those off days. I've seen players appreciate how these aren't bogged down by endless fine print; contributions are solid on slots at 100%, though table games chip in less at 10-20%, so plan accordingly if blackjack's your jam.

What makes these deals relatable is their crypto twist—deposit with Bitcoin or Ethereum, and you're still eligible, no weird exclusions. Just remember the short expiry dates mean you can't sit on them; it's designed for active players who like to jump in and wager without delay. Handling Your Money: Crypto-First but Flexible Options

Deposits and withdrawals at CyberBet lean heavily into the crypto world, supporting Bitcoin, Ethereum, Dogecoin, and more, which means instant transactions without the usual bank delays—perfect if you're tired of waiting days for funds to clear. Traditional methods like Webmoney are there too, and currencies span USD, EUR, GBP, and even direct crypto holdings, keeping things versatile for global users. Minimums start low at around €20 equivalent, and with no maximum cashout on most bonus winnings, you can aim big without caps holding you back.

On the flip side, payouts are speedy via crypto (often within hours), but expect verification checks before your first withdrawal—standard stuff like ID docs to keep things secure. It's worth noting that while it's crypto-friendly, there aren't fiat-heavy options like credit cards, so if you're not into digital wallets, this might feel limiting.
